Fees

Mesothelioma lawyers usually work on a contingency-fee basis, which means that clients pay no upfront fees and only pay if they win. You should ask the law firm about any other costs that may be associated with your case. For instance, some firms may charge photocopies or court filing fees, while others might include these expenses in the contingency fee. Asbestos was extensively used in the United States up until the 1980s, when its dangers were fully recognized. Workers working in areas like power mines, power plants and construction areas were exposed to asbestos, and many of them developed mesothelioma. Also, those who lived in homes built with asbestos were also at risk for exposure.
